Understanding Your Style and Needs

Before diving into the world of sideboards, take a moment to assess your personal style and storage requirements. Do you lean towards a modern, rustic, mid-century modern, farmhouse, contemporary, or industrial aesthetic? Consider the room where the sideboard will reside – is it a living room, dining room, entryway, or even a bedroom?

Knowing your style will help you narrow down the options. For a modern space, a gray sideboard with brass hardware or a white contemporary sideboard with soft-close doors might be ideal. If you prefer a rustic look, consider a buffet in a rustic style. For a mid-century modern vibe, look for a console table with hairpin legs.

Next, think about what you need to store. Do you require drawers for smaller items, glass doors to display cherished belongings, adjustable shelves for versatility, or a wine rack for your collection? Consider a sideboard with open shelving for easy access to everyday items.

Exploring the Versatility of Sideboards

Sideboards aren't just for dining rooms anymore. Their versatility allows them to seamlessly integrate into various areas of your home.

  • Living Room: A sideboard can serve as a media console, providing storage for electronics, games, and other living room essentials. A wide gray buffet can anchor the space and offer ample surface area for displaying decorative items.
  • Dining Room: The classic location for a sideboard, it offers convenient storage for dishes, silverware, and serving pieces. An oak sideboard for the dining room is a timeless choice.
  • Entryway: A narrow oak sideboard for the entryway can provide a stylish landing spot for keys, mail, and other essentials.
  • Bedroom: A sideboard can function as a dresser, offering ample drawer space for clothing and accessories. Consider a rustic style sideboard for the bedroom to add warmth and character.

Choosing the Right Materials, Finishes, and Features

The materials and finishes you select will significantly impact the overall look and feel of your sideboard.

  • Wood: Oak, walnut, mango wood, and reclaimed wood are popular choices, each offering a unique grain pattern and warmth. Oak is a classic, durable option, while walnut provides a richer, more luxurious feel. Mango wood offers a more exotic look, and reclaimed wood brings a rustic charm.
  • Finishes: White, black, gray, blue, and green are common colors. White sideboards offer a clean, contemporary look, while black adds a touch of drama. Gray is a versatile neutral that complements various décor styles.
  • Hardware: Gold, silver, and brass hardware can elevate the design. White sideboards with gold hardware exude elegance, while black sideboards with silver hardware offer a sleek, modern aesthetic.
  • Special Features: Look for features like soft-close doors, cable management systems, sliding doors, geometric designs, rattan doors, and metal or wooden legs to enhance functionality and style. A sideboard with cable management is perfect for a living room setup, while soft-close doors add a touch of luxury.
